A lawyer can also guarantee a claim is filed within the timeframe of limitations.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Statute of Limitations&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;The statute of limitations is a legal term that describes the maximum time that families and victims can sue asbestos. The time limit is determined by law of the state and varies by state. To ensure that claims are filed on time, victims should consult [https://informatic.wiki/wiki/4_Dirty_Little_Tips_About_Albany_Mesothelioma_Attorney_And_The_Albany_Mesothelioma_Attorney_Industry mesothelioma lawyers].&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;A family member or a victim might not be able to receive financial compensation for their losses and injuries when they fail to file by the deadline. [https://pattern-wiki.win/wiki/Whats_The_Reason_Mount_Pleasant_Mesothelioma_Lawyer_Vimeo_Is_Fast_Becoming_The_Hottest_Trend_Of_2023 Mesothelioma lawyers] can help clients learn about the statute of limitations in their state and assist them with preparing an effective mesothelioma asbestos lawsuit.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;As with other personal injury claims, asbestos exposure claims are typically subject to specific rules concerning the time limit for filing. The majority of states, for instance, have a rule known as the discovery rule. The discovery rule means that the statute of limitations clock is not set to start until a victim is diagnosed with an asbestos-related illness. This is because many asbestos-related diseases like mesothelioma are not discovered until years after exposure to the harmful substance.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;According to a 1973 court case in the Eastern District of Texas (Borel v. Fibreboard Paper Products Corporation), the discovery rule was established to safeguard asbestos plaintiffs. If the statute of limitation were interpreted the same way as it is in other personal injury cases, the majority of victims would not be able to sue because the period of latency is too long for mesothelioma.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Mesothelioma patients often have to fight to get financial compensation from companies which expose them to asbestos exposure. The negligent companies should be held accountable.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Statute of limitations&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;The statute of limitations can be complicated by the fact that asbestos-related diseases such as mesothelioma may take years to manifest. An experienced lawyer can assist victims in determining their deadlines, and then filing within them. The lawyer will examine the claim and inform the defendants. The lawyer will then construct the case using evidence, or negotiate a settlement with the defendants or go to court for a verdict by a jury.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;State-specific statutes of limitations for personal injury and wrongful deaths cases vary. There are many factors that affect how the statute of limitations is used, including when asbestos exposure occurred, where the victim lives, which states they worked in, and the location of asbestos-related companies.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Most asbestos sufferers benefit from the rule of discovery, which allows a statute of limitations clock to start at the time the disease was discovered or when it should have been discovered. This differs from the state&#039;s statute of limitations, which usually start on the date of exposure.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;The statute of limitations can be tolled, or paused in certain circumstances, like when the victim was a minor or lacks legal capacity to file. In certain cases, such as fraud concealment the statute of limitations may be extended.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;If the statute of limitations runs out before a mesothelioma lawsuit is filed, the victims may be denied compensation. A lawyer can look over and assist with the application of a mesothelioma trust claim.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Asbestos Trust Funds&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Asbestos victims who suffer from mesothelioma or other asbestos-related diseases can seek compensation through trust funds. These funds are set up by companies that produced or supplied asbestos-containing products that ended up in bankruptcy. These companies were ordered by bankruptcy courts to set aside money in trusts in order to pay the victims of asbestos-containing products.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;To receive financial compensation, victims must meet the eligibility requirements of each asbestos trust.
